New Delhi, Nov. 1 -- Andrew Mountbatten Windsor, the disgraced former Duke of York, is reportedly set to receive a large, one-time six-figure payment and an annual stipend as he gets used to life as a commoner.

The development comes following King Charles' decision to strip the former Prince of all his titles over his connection with disgraced financier and conv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ein.

According to a report by The Guardian, Andrew is set to receive an initial six-figure sum to cover his move from the Royal Lodge in Windsor to a private accommodation in Norfolk.

In addition to the aforementioned one-off payment, Andrew is also set to receive an annuity, which will be paid from King Charles' private funds.
